Saint Lucia is one of the worst islands to hitch hike in the Caribbean, but is still better than the majority of other countries in the world. It is not common but people will know that you need a lift and the large Christian community will be quite willing to stop. St Lucia has a bad reputation compared with it's neighbouring islands but is still fairly safe.
Entrance requirements
Contrary to what was written here previously, you can enter St. Lucia without an onward ticket - just don't sound like an idiot that doesn't know how long they want to stay or where they're going next - simple. Quite easy to be 'landed' from a boats crew if you've hitched there.
Ferries
There is a fast ferry to/from Martinique (approx €80 one way), the water bus from La Marina (Martinique) does not appear to run anymore (was a similar price anyway). No ferry to SV&G.
Experience
Hitchhikernick - hitched there in may 2024 and July 2017. Hitched without incident on either trip and got given money and food on both occasions. was told to be careful around Castries at night but managed to find bush to camp at night pretty easily in the nearby hills. There does appear to be a lot more homelessness in soufriere than I remember. Did not experience any aggression here unlike in Dominica and Antigua, but that was only arbitrary. definitely more free roaming dogs, but not aggressive. Average waiting time 15 mins.
